Callduron wrote:
No, it's going to cost about the same. Each run makes 4 blocks of fuel.


Depending on how much HW/LO you used before, small towers will get 10-20% cheaper, medium towers 5-10% cheaper and large towers about 3-6% cheaper.

Small towers gained the most because now their isotope/fuel requirements are exactly 1/4 of a large tower instead of being more like 1/3 of a large tower's fuel needs.
